CancellationTokenRegistration.DisposeAsync CancellationTokenRegistration.DisposeAsync CancellationTokenRegistration.DisposeAsync CancellationTokenRegistration.DisposeAsync Method

定義

登録を破棄して、関連付けられている CancellationToken から対象のコールバックの登録を解除します。Disposes of the registration and unregisters the target callback from the associated CancellationToken.

public:
 virtual System::Threading::Tasks::ValueTask DisposeAsync();
public System.Threading.Tasks.ValueTask DisposeAsync ();
abstract member DisposeAsync : unit -> System.Threading.Tasks.ValueTask
override this.DisposeAsync : unit -> System.Threading.Tasks.ValueTask
Public Function DisposeAsync () As ValueTask

戻り値

非同期の破棄操作を表すタスク。A task that represents the asynchronous dispose operation.

実装

注釈

返さValueTaskれたは、関連付けられたコールバックが実行されない場合、または実行が完了した後に、コールバックが自身の登録を解除している場合を除き、完了した後に完了します。The returned ValueTask completes once the associated callback is unregistered without having executed or once it's finished executing, except in the degenerate case where the callback is unregistering itself.

適用対象